  1. Weatherization Assistant:Ramp Up Support Mark Ternes Mike Gettings Oak Ridge National Laboratory 2009 National Weatherization Training Conference July 21, 2009

Objectives • Improve communications regarding the Weatherization Assistant • Ensure that the training needs for the Weatherization Assistant are met over the next several years • Expand the Weatherization Assistant’s information management capabilities to assist states and local agencies • Reduce the time and complexity associated with developing priority lists using the Weatherization Assistant • Perform technical enhancements to the Weatherization Assistant needed to support ramp up activities

  3. Communications • Weatherization Assistant newsletter • Updates • Training • Common errors • Programming tips • Input from states on training and information management needs • Emails • Phone calls • Conference call • How would you like to be kept informed?

Training • Established training will be continued • National, regional, and state training conferences • 3-day trainings on the basics of using the Weatherization Assistant and the NEAT and MHEA audits as requested by states • Web-based training • Individual training alternative to group training and/or prerequisite to group training • Basic course equivalent to 3-day group training • Work orders • Other advanced features in the Weatherization Assistant

Training (continued) • Centralized Group Training • Scheduled trainings at regionally dispersed cities (e.g., Atlanta, St. Louis, Denver) as alternative to state trainings • 3-day basic training, but possibly other subjects • Webinar Trainings • Short trainings of 1-3 hours on a specific subject • Examples: reports, data transfer, use of the survey feature, measure costs • Any specific training topics or approaches? • Is there a need for train-the-trainer?

Information Management • Facilitate centralized data storage at the state and for agencies not using a server to improve data analysis and reporting • Client-server design • Enhancement to current software • Optional transfer of information over the internet • Web application • New user interface • Must be connected to the internet • Easier to ensure that all agencies in a state using the same version • Easier to assist in setting up the Setup Library and ensuring consistency in the Setup Libraries

Information Management (continued) • Weatherization Assistant enhancements • Additional reports • New form to easily identify measures installed, actual costs, and funding sources used • Basic information needed for program evaluation • Expanded technical assistance • Customized reports • To states interested in integrating the Weatherization Assistant into their state information management system • What information management needs would you like to see addressed in the near future?

  8. Priority Lists • Write a manual on how to develop priority lists using the Weatherization Assistant • Idea of automating the Weatherization Assistant to help develop priority lists was tabled • Would a priority list manual be useful to you?

Technical Enhancements • Continue making enhancements to NEAT and MHEA requested by users • Incorporate new technologies into NEAT and MHEA • Develop a multifamily audit • Any other technical enhancements needed to support your ramp up activities? • Would a simplified user interface be useful?
